The lively history of a London Livery Company which has survived five hundred years of continuous challenge, occasional danger, and sometimes the threat of dissolution. Blue boards, gilt title to spine and crest to front. Colour & b/w photos. ISBN: 0946604223. Minimal bumping to spine.
